A Legacy of Excellence

Northeast Missouri State Bank (NEMO Bank) has been a trusted financial institution in the Northeast Missouri region for over 125 years. Headquartered in Kirksville, Missouri, NEMO Bank has established a reputation for stability, service, and community involvement.

Financial Strength and Stability

NEMO Bank maintains a strong financial position, evidenced by its consistently high ratings from independent financial institutions. As of December 31, 2022:

  • Total assets: $1.2 billion
  • Total deposits: $1 billion
  • Tier 1 risk-based capital ratio: 12.03% (well above the regulatory minimum of 8%)
  • Deposit insurance coverage: FDIC-insured up to the maximum amount allowed by law

Tips and Tricks for Banking

  • Set financial goals: Determine your short-term and long-term financial objectives to guide your banking decisions.
  • Budget and track expenses: Create a budget to monitor your income and expenses, ensuring that you live within your means.
  • Save regularly: Make saving a priority by setting up automatic transfers from your checking to a savings account.
  • Monitor your credit: Check your credit report regularly to ensure accuracy and identify any potential issues.
  • Protect your identity: Be vigilant in protecting your personal and financial information from fraud and theft.
